Azure Device Update for IoT Hub の制限
この記事では、Azure Device Update for IoT Hub リソースとそれに関連する操作のさまざまな制限の概要を説明します。 この記事では、Microsoft サポートに問い合わせて Standard SKU の制限を調整できるかどうかについても説明しています。
一般提供の制限
次の表では、Standard レベルと Free レベルの Device Update サービスの制限について説明します。
制限は、Standard SKU に関してのみ調整できます。 制限調整要求はケース バイ ケースで評価され、承認は保証されません。
無料の SKU に関する制限調整要求は受け付けられません。 また、無料の SKU インスタンスは Standard SKU インスタンスにアップグレードできません。
次の表は、Azure Resource Manager での Device Update for IoT Hub リソースに関する制限を示しています。
リソース | Standard SKU の制限 | 無料の SKU の制限 | Standard SKU では調整可能ですか? |
---|---|---|---|
サブスクリプションあたりのアカウント数 | 50 | 1 | いいえ |
アカウントあたりのインスタンス数 | 50 | 1 | いいえ |
アカウント名の長さ | 3 から 24 文字 | 3 から 24 文字 | いいえ |
インスタンス名の長さ | 3 から 36 文字 | 3 から 36 文字 | いいえ |
次の表は、さまざまな Device Update 操作に関連する制限を示しています。
操作 | Standard SKU の制限 | 無料の SKU の制限 | Standard SKU では調整可能ですか? |
---|---|---|---|
インスタンスあたりのデバイス数 | 100 万 | 10 | はい |
インスタンスあたりのデバイス グループ数 | 100 | 10 | はい |
インスタンスあたりのデバイス クラス数 | 80 | 10 | はい |
インスタンスあたりのアクティブなデプロイの数 | 50 (取り消しのために予約されている 1 つを含む) | 5 (取り消しのために予約されている 1 つを含む) | はい |
インスタンスあたりのデプロイの合計数 (すべてのアクティブなデプロイ、非アクティブなデプロイ、削除されていない取り消されたデプロイを含む) | 100 | 20 | いいえ |
インスタンスあたりの更新プロバイダー数 | 25 | 2 | いいえ |
インスタンスごとのプロバイダーあたりの更新名の数 | 25 | 2 | いいえ |
インスタンスごとの更新プロバイダーおよび更新名あたりの更新バージョン数 | 100 | 5 | いいえ |
インスタンスあたりの更新回数の合計 | 100 | 10 | いいえ |
1 つの更新ファイルの最大サイズ | 2 GB | 2 GB | はい |
1 回のインポート操作の全ファイルの最大合計サイズ | 2 GB | 2 GB | はい |
1 つの更新に含まれるファイルの最大数 | 10 | 10 | いいえ |
インスタンスあたりのデータ ストレージの合計 | 100 GB | 5 GB | いいえ |
Note
取り消されたデプロイや非アクティブなデプロイは、デプロイ合計数の制限にカウントされます。 新しいデプロイを作成できるように、これらのデプロイを必ず定期的にクリーンアップしてください。
大きなファイルのダウンロードの要件
ファイル サイズが 100 MB を超える大きなファイル パッケージをデプロイするには、信頼性の高いダウンロード パフォーマンスのためにバイト範囲要求を使用することをお勧めします。 Device Update では、サイズが 1 MB の範囲要求で最適に動作するコンテンツ配信ネットワーク (CDN) が使用されます。 100 MB を超える範囲要求はサポートされていません。
スロットル制限
次の表は、すべての Device Update レベルでの操作に適用されるスロットルを示しています。 値は、個々の Device Update インスタンスに適用されます。
Device Update サービス API | 調整率 |
---|---|
GetGroups | 30/分 |
GetGroupDetails | 30/分 |
グループごとの GetBestUpdates | 30/分 |
グループごとの GetUpdateCompliance | 30/分 |
GetAllUpdateCompliance | 30/分 |
GetSubgroupUpdateCompliance | 30/分 |
GetSubgroupBestUpdates | 30/分 |
CreateOrUpdateDeployment | 6 分 |
DeleteDeployment | 6 分 |
ProcessSubgroupDeployment | 6 分 |
Delete Update | 510/分* |
Get File | 510/分* |
操作状態の取得 | 510/分* |
Get Update | 510/分* |
Import Update | 510/分* |
ファイルの一覧表示 | 510/分* |
List Names | 510/分* |
List Providers | 510/分* |
List Updates | 510/分* |
List Versions | 510/分* |
List Operation Statuses | 50/分 |
* 1 分あたりの呼び出し数は、リストされているすべての操作で共有されます。
また、非同期インポートと削除の同時操作数は、合計 10 操作ジョブに制限されます。